NotesFAQContact Us
Collection
Advanced
Search Tips
Showing all 4 results Save | Export
Peer reviewed Peer reviewed
Direct linkDirect link
Mangaroska, Katerina; Sharma, Kshitij; Gaševic, Dragan; Giannakos, Michail – Journal of Computer Assisted Learning, 2022
Background: Problem-solving is a multidimensional and dynamic process that requires and interlinks cognitive, metacognitive, and affective dimensions of learning. However, current approaches practiced in computing education research (CER) are not sufficient to capture information beyond the basic programming process data (i.e., IDE-log data).…
Descriptors: Cognitive Processes, Psychological Patterns, Problem Solving, Programming
Peer reviewed Peer reviewed
Direct linkDirect link
Almasseri, Mohammed; AlHojailan, Mohammed I. – Journal of Computer Assisted Learning, 2019
The study aims to identify the effect of a flipped classroom approach designed according to the cognitive theory of multimedia learning on the academic achievements of eighth-grade students (aged 14 years) in Saudi Arabia in computer science. To this end, a quasi-experimental design was used, with a sample of 67 students; 33 students were assigned…
Descriptors: Foreign Countries, Blended Learning, Instructional Effectiveness, Academic Achievement
Peer reviewed Peer reviewed
Direct linkDirect link
Chatzopoulou, D. I.; Economides, A. A. – Journal of Computer Assisted Learning, 2010
This paper presents Programming Adaptive Testing (PAT), a Web-based adaptive testing system for assessing students' programming knowledge. PAT was used in two high school programming classes by 73 students. The question bank of PAT is composed of 443 questions. A question is classified in one out of three difficulty levels. In PAT, the levels of…
Descriptors: Student Evaluation, Prior Learning, Programming, High School Students
Peer reviewed Peer reviewed
Journal of Computer Assisted Learning, 1990
Describes activities of the Educational Technology Center at Harvard University, which focus on the use of computers and other technology to improve K-12 instruction in science, mathematics, and computing. Topics discussed include curriculum development; students' prior conceptions; the construction of scientific knowledge; the use of software;…
Descriptors: Computer Assisted Instruction, Computer Science Education, Courseware, Curriculum Development